概括
远距离双肩肌破裂是一种罕见的损伤,伴随着臂创伤. 通过仔细的病史和手术内触摸进行早期诊断,对于成功治疗和恢复肘部曲至关重要.

背景情况:
- 臂损伤可以导致显著的上肢功能障碍.
- 远距离双肩肌破裂不常见,但可能会使手臂创伤的管理复杂化.
- 诊断可能是具有挑战性的,因为并发的四肢麻.
研究的目的:
- 突出突出发生和诊断挑战的远距离二头肌肌破裂在患者手臂损伤的伤害.
- 强调特定的诊断操作的重要性.
主要方法:
- 病例报告详细介绍了两名手臂损伤的患者,他们经历了远距离双肩肌破裂.
- 对包括神经移植和肌重建在内的外科手术进行审查.
- 评估功能结果,特别是肘部曲.
主要成果:
- 一名患有上臂关节损伤的患者患有未被识别的远距离双肩肌破裂,手术后诊断出这种情况.
- 第二个患有C5-T1损伤的患者在手术期间被诊断出患有远距离双肩肌破裂.
- 两位患者在一年的随访中都实现了重力辅助肘部曲.
结论:
- 远距离双肩肌破裂是一种罕见的并发性损伤与手臂创伤.
- 详细的患者病史和双肩肌的手术内触摸对于准确的诊断至关重要.
- 及时识别和管理是恢复肘部曲功能的关键.

The radius is longer of the two bones that make up the human antebrachium or forearm. At the proximal end, the radius articulates with the capitulum of the humerus and the radial notch of the ulna to form the elbow joint. At the distal end, the radius articulates with the ulna via the ulnar notch, forming the distal radioulnar joint. Distally, the radius also attaches to the carpal wrist bones (scaphoid and lunate) to form the radiocarpal joint.

The upper limb consists of the arm, forearm, wrist, and hand bones. The humerus is the single bone of the upper arm region. Proximally, it has a large, spherical, smooth head that articulates with the glenoid cavity of the scapula to form the glenohumeral or shoulder joint. The margin of the head is the anatomical neck, a residual epiphyseal plate. Laterally it extends to form bony projections called the greater tubercle and the lesser tubercle.
